Fullstack Developer

Fullstack Developer

Leeds Freelance 36000 - 60000 £ / year (est.) No home office possible
R

At a Glance

  • Tasks: Lead the full development cycle, from design to launch, enhancing user onboarding.
  • Company: Join a top organisation connecting millions on the 'front page of the internet.'
  • Benefits: Enjoy remote work options and a supportive environment with mentorship opportunities.
  • Why this job: Be part of a high-impact team shaping innovative products for a global audience.
  • Qualifications: 5+ years in software engineering with strong UI component development skills required.
  • Other info: Collaborate with cross-functional teams and mentor junior engineers in a dynamic setting.

The predicted salary is between 36000 - 60000 £ per year.

Join a leading organization that connects millions of people through shared interests on the "front page of the internet." We’re committed to driving growth through innovative products and seamless user experiences. As part of our Growth team, you will help shape the technical and product strategies behind one of the largest sites in the world.

In this high-impact role, you will be responsible for the full development cycle—from technical design and development to testing, experimentation, analysis, and launch. You’ll work cross-functionally with product, design, and engineering teams to build novel products and features that enhance the user onboarding experience. Additionally, you'll contribute to developer workflows, mentor junior engineers, and help drive continuous improvements across the technical landscape.

Key Responsibilities:
  • Cross-Functional Collaboration: Partner with product, design, and engineering teams to execute the overall product and business strategy. Work closely with stakeholders to ensure technical solutions align with business needs.
  • Product & Feature Development: Develop innovative products and features focused on enhancing the user onboarding experience. Lead the full development cycle, including technical design, coding, testing, experimentation, analysis, and successful product launches.
  • Technical Leadership: Review code, design documents, and product specifications, providing constructive feedback. Establish and promote best practices to improve developer workflows. Mentor junior engineers, supporting their professional and technical growth.
  • Continuous Improvement: Stay updated on emerging technologies and methodologies to continuously improve both technical and non-technical skills. Recommend enhancements to existing systems and processes for improved performance and scalability.
Required Experience & Skills:
  • Technical Expertise: A minimum of 5+ years of software engineering experience. Strong background in developing user-facing, reusable UI components. Proficiency in managing application state and optimizing performance in one or more general-purpose programming languages such as TypeScript, JavaScript, Go, Java, Rust, or C++.
  • API & Protocol Knowledge: Familiarity with GraphQL, REST, and HTTP fundamentals. Ability to design and maintain efficient and scalable APIs.
  • Organizational & Communication Skills: Excellent organizational skills, with a strong ability to prioritize tasks and deliver projects on schedule. Outstanding verbal and written communication skills to effectively collaborate with remote teams and explain complex technical topics.
  • Leadership & Innovation: Demonstrated experience in technical leadership. A self-directed, entrepreneurial spirit with a passion for innovation. Ability to thrive in fast-paced, dynamic environments.

What We Offer:

  • The opportunity to work remotely within the UK.
  • A collaborative, high-impact role at a globally recognized organization.
  • The chance to work on a platform that connects millions of users.
  • A supportive environment with opportunities for mentorship and continuous learning.

Fullstack Developer employer: Russell Tobin

As a Fullstack Developer at our leading organisation, you will thrive in a collaborative and innovative environment that values your contributions and fosters professional growth. Enjoy the flexibility of remote work within the UK while being part of a team that connects millions through cutting-edge technology, with ample opportunities for mentorship and continuous learning to enhance your skills and career trajectory.
R

Contact Detail:

Russell Tobin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Fullstack Developer

✨Tip Number 1

Familiarise yourself with the technologies mentioned in the job description, such as TypeScript, JavaScript, and API protocols like GraphQL and REST. Being able to discuss your experience with these technologies during an interview will show that you're well-prepared and technically proficient.

✨Tip Number 2

Highlight your experience in cross-functional collaboration. Prepare examples of how you've successfully worked with product, design, and engineering teams in the past. This will demonstrate your ability to thrive in a collaborative environment, which is crucial for this role.

✨Tip Number 3

Showcase your leadership skills by discussing any mentoring or coaching experiences you have had with junior engineers. This aligns with the company's focus on technical leadership and will help you stand out as a candidate who can contribute to team growth.

✨Tip Number 4

Stay updated on emerging technologies and methodologies relevant to full-stack development. Mention any recent projects or learning experiences that demonstrate your commitment to continuous improvement, as this is a key aspect of the role.

We think you need these skills to ace Fullstack Developer

Full Stack Development
Proficiency in TypeScript, JavaScript, Go, Java, Rust, or C++
Experience with UI Component Development
API Design and Maintenance
Familiarity with GraphQL and REST
Performance Optimisation
Technical Design Skills
Testing and Experimentation
Cross-Functional Collaboration
Code Review and Feedback
Mentoring Junior Engineers
Organisational Skills
Effective Communication Skills
Leadership Experience
Adaptability to Emerging Technologies

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in full-stack development, particularly focusing on your proficiency with programming languages like TypeScript, JavaScript, or Go. Emphasise any experience you have with API design and user-facing UI components.

Craft a Compelling Cover Letter: In your cover letter, express your passion for innovation and technical leadership. Mention specific projects where you've collaborated cross-functionally and how you contributed to enhancing user experiences.

Showcase Technical Skills: Include a section in your application that showcases your technical skills, particularly your experience with GraphQL, REST, and HTTP. Provide examples of how you've designed and maintained efficient APIs in previous roles.

Highlight Leadership Experience: If you have experience mentoring junior engineers or leading projects, make sure to highlight this in your application. Companies value candidates who can contribute to team growth and promote best practices.

How to prepare for a job interview at Russell Tobin

✨Showcase Your Technical Skills

Be prepared to discuss your experience with various programming languages and frameworks, especially those mentioned in the job description. Highlight specific projects where you developed user-facing components or optimised application performance.

✨Demonstrate Cross-Functional Collaboration

Since the role involves working closely with product, design, and engineering teams, be ready to share examples of how you've successfully collaborated across different functions in previous roles. This will show your ability to align technical solutions with business needs.

✨Prepare for Technical Leadership Questions

Expect questions about your experience in mentoring junior engineers and leading technical projects. Think of instances where you provided constructive feedback or established best practices that improved workflows.

✨Communicate Clearly and Effectively

Given the remote nature of the role, strong communication skills are essential. Practice explaining complex technical topics in a simple way, as this will demonstrate your ability to collaborate effectively with remote teams.

Fullstack Developer
Russell Tobin
R
  • Fullstack Developer

    Leeds
    Freelance
    36000 - 60000 £ / year (est.)

    Application deadline: 2027-04-16

  • R

    Russell Tobin

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>